国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 語言 > JavaScript > 正文

JS注冊頁面的簡單實例

2024-05-06 15:45:32
字體:
來源:轉載
供稿:網友

JS注冊頁面在JavaScript是經常會用到的,今天小編就將帶領大家去學習JS注冊頁面的簡單實例,這個方法小編覺得挺不錯的,希望能給大家帶來幫助,現在我們就一起去了解具體內容吧。

如下所示:

<!DOCTYPE html><html>  <head>    <meta charset="UTF-8">    <title></title>  </head>  <script src="js/jquery-1.8.0.min.js"></script>  <script>//    $(function(){//      $("input[name='uname']").blur(function(){//        var unamestr = $(this).val();//        var regstr = /^[/u4e00-/u9fa5]{2,4}$/;//2到4位漢字//        //      });//    });    function checkname(){      var regstr = /^[/u4e00-/u9fa5]{2,4}$/; //^匹配開始 $匹配結束,2到4位漢字      var namestr = document.regform.uname.value;      if(!regstr.test(namestr)){        x = document.getElementById("errorname").innerHTML="必須2-4位漢字";//        x.style.color="green";        return false;              }      x=document.getElementById("errorname").innerHTML="格式正確";//      x.style.color="red";      return true;    }    function checkpass(){      var regstr = /^/w{6,8}$/;//  ^匹配開始 $匹配結束   /w表示數字字母下劃線      var passstr = document.regform.upass.value;      if(!regstr.test(passstr)){        document.getElementById("errorpwd").innerHTML="必須是6-8位數字,字母或下劃線";        return false;      }      document.getElementById("errorpwd").innerHTML="格式正確";      return true;    }    function checkpass2(){            var passstr = document.regform.upass.value;      var passstr2 = document.regform.upass2.value;//      alert("fds");      if(passstr==passstr2){        document.getElementById("errorpwd2").innerHTML="兩次密碼輸入一致";        return true;      }            document.getElementById("errorpwd2").innerHTML="兩次密碼輸入不一致";      return false;    }    function checkForm(){      if(checkname()&&checkpass()&&checkpass2())        return true;      return false;    }    var citylist = new Array();    citylist[0] = ["海淀區","朝陽區","東城區"];    citylist[1] = ["石家莊","邢臺","邯鄲","保定"];    citylist[2] = ["鄭州","開封","洛陽"];    function changecity(prov){      //清空選項框中的選項      document.regform.selcity.innerHTML = "";      if(prov == "0"){        document.regform.selcity.innerHTML = "<option value='0'>選擇城市</option>";        return;      }      var provindex = parseInt(prov)-1;      var citys = citylist[provindex];        var optionsstr = "";        for(var i = 0; i < citys.length; i++) {          var city = citys[i];          optionsstr += "<option value='" + city + "'>" + city + "</option>";        }        document.regform.selcity.innerHTML = optionsstr;    }      </script>  <style>    body {      font-size: 14px;    }        #home {      width: 600px;      height: 300px;      background-color: aquamarine;      margin: auto;/*div居中*/      margin-top: 50px;      padding-top: 20px;    }        .dl1 {      clear: both;    }        .dl1 dt {      width: 150px;      float: left;      height: 30px;      line-height: 30px;      text-align: right;    }        .dl1 dd {      padding-top: 8px;      float: left;    }    #div1{      padding-top: 45px;      width: 120px;      margin: auto;    }    h1{      text-align: center;    }  </style>  <body>        <div id="home">      <h1>用戶注冊</h1>      <form action="index.html" name="regform" method="post" onsubmit="return checkForm()">        <dl class="dl1">          <dt>用戶姓名 : </dt>          <dd><input type="text" name="uname" onblur="checkname()" /></dd>          <dd id="errorname"></dd>        </dl>        <dl class="dl1">          <dt>用戶密碼 : </dt>          <dd><input type="password" name="upass" onblur="checkpass()"/></dd>          <dd id="errorpwd"></dd>        </dl>        <dl class="dl1">          <dt>再次輸入密碼 : </dt>          <dd><input type="password" name="upass2" onblur="checkpass2()" /></dd>          <dd id="errorpwd2"></dd>        </dl>        <dl class="dl1">          <dt>用戶性別 : </dt>          <dd>            <input type="radio" name="sex" checked="checked" />男            <input type="radio" name="sex" />女          </dd>          <dd id="errorpwd"></dd>        </dl>        <dl class="dl1">          <dt>用戶愛好 : </dt>          <dd>            <input type="checkbox" />上網            <input type="checkbox" />讀書            <input type="checkbox" />唱歌          </dd>        </dl>        <dl class="dl1">          <dt>用戶籍貫 : </dt>          <dd>            <select name="selprov" onchange="changecity(this.value)">              <option value="0">選擇省份</option>              <option value="1">北京</option>              <option value="2">河北</option>              <option value="3">河南</option>            </select>          </dd>          <dd>            <select name="selcity">              <option value="0">選擇城市</option>            </select>          </dd>        </dl>        <div id="div1">          <input type="submit" value="提交"/>          ?<input type="reset" value="重置"/>        </div>      </form>    </div>  </body></html>

以上這篇JS注冊頁面的簡單實例就是小編分享給大家的全部內容了,歡迎您收藏本站,我們將為您提供最新的JavaScript資源。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表

圖片精選

主站蜘蛛池模板: 尖扎县| 遵化市| 法库县| 临泉县| 漠河县| 汽车| 高邮市| 建湖县| 新安县| 桐梓县| 和政县| 山阴县| 萝北县| 墨竹工卡县| 桂林市| 德庆县| 黔西| 利津县| 襄汾县| 普格县| 白山市| 广南县| 行唐县| 滨海县| 太和县| 洪湖市| 江永县| 革吉县| 克拉玛依市| 遂川县| 吴旗县| 工布江达县| 大理市| 灌云县| 佛教| 巢湖市| 乐清市| 临江市| 海兴县| 沁水县| 宜良县|